Transaction 81dbedfe132f060cde36e9cfca13c4d6d894d8026cdaa49371f5b14af4029ef3
1 Input
1 Output
-
81dbedfe132f060cde36e9cfca13c4d6d894d8026cdaa49371f5b14af4029ef3:0
- value
- 5391647
- script pubkey
- OP_0 OP_PUSHBYTES_32 1c5c30c89836a0fdd7d919c9a8a67bbffe26ac6c96202c7760e398199646631d
- address
- bc1qr3wrpjycx6s0m47er8y63fnmhllzdtrvjcszcamquwvpn9jxvvwslwgu9m